    South Side Sportsmen's Club was a recreational club that catered to the wealthy businessmen of Long Island during the gold coast era from the 1870s through the 1960s. Its main clubhouse and other facilities were added to the National Register of Historic Places as the Southside Sportsmens Club District in 1973, and are today contained within the Connetquot River State Park Preserve.

    Southside Park is, at 211 acres (0.85 km 2), the largest park in the City of Atlanta. [1] It is located along Jonesboro Road in the southern part of the city just north of the Perimeter (I-285) . Its rank as the city's largest park is set to be eclipsed by the new Westside Park at 351 acres (1.42 km 2 ).

    South Side School opened in 1922 due Florida land boom of the 1920s. The architect of the South Side School was John Peterman and the builder was Cayot and Hart. [3] In 1949 the school was expanded, it was enlarged again in 1954. South Side School was changed from an elementary school in 1967 to be a school for special needs children.
